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Lake Tekapo

    Start point
    JUCY Snooze, 5 Peter Leeming Rd, Christchurch, Canterbury 8053, New Zealand (Outside Main Entrance of Lylo Christchurch (Formally Jucy Snooze), 09:00 - 09:15)
    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Explore local bike trails
    • Relax in lakeside hot springs
    • Stargazing at Dark Sky Reserve
    Landmarks
    Lake Tekapo
    Aoraki Mackenzie International Dark Sky Reserve
  2. Day 2

    Lake Tekapo to Queenstown

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Travel through Mackenzie Country
    • Travel over Lindis Pass
    Landmarks
    Mackenzie Country
    Lindis Pass
    Itinerary Image 1Itinerary Image 2Itinerary Image 3
  3. Day 3

    Coronet Peak

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• NZ Ski bus and lift pass

    Optional Activities

    • Skiing or snowboarding at Coronet Peak
    • Drink at a bar in Queenstown
    • Dine at Fergburger
    Landmarks
    Coronet Peak
    Itinerary Image 1Itinerary Image 2Itinerary Image 3
  4. Day 4

    The Remarkables

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(1 Group Dinner)

    Included Activities

    • NZ Ski bus and lift pass

    Optional Activities

    • Skiing or snowboarding at The Remarkables
    Landmarks
    The Remarkables
    Itinerary Image 1Itinerary Image 2Itinerary Image 3
  5. Day 5

    Queenstown to Franz Josef

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Stop in Wanaka
    • Travel over Haast Pass
    • Travel along rugged coastline
    Landmarks
    Wanaka
    Haast Pass
  6. Day 6

    Franz Josef

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Optional Activities

    • Hiking on Franz Josef Glacier
    • Helicopter tour of Franz Josef Glacier
    • Franz Josef Glacier Heli-Hike from $469
    • Quad biking from $180
    • Kayaking from $115
    • Glacier hot pools
    Landmarks
    Franz Josef Glacier
  7. Day 7

    Franz Josef to Christchurch

    End point
    JUCY Snooze, 5 Peter Leeming Rd, Christchurch, Canterbury 8053, New Zealand (Outside Main Entrance of Lylo Christchurch (Formally Jucy Snooze), 16:00 - 16:30)
    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Stop at Hokitika
    • Travel through Arthur's Pass
    • Church of the Good Shepherd
    • Castle Rock Walk
    Landmarks
    Hokitika
    Arthur's Pass
    Church of the Good Shepherd
    Castle Rock

    I don't know how to ski, so I was wondering if this tour suits me, I really like snow though. Meanwhile, if we want to ski, do we need to pay extra fees for it or it is included?

    Tour Details
    Transport
    • Wild KiwiOperatorWritten May 2023

      This tour would be fine for you, even though you do not know how to ski. As it is not fully focused on skiing. You can hire gear, skis, and the mountain pass whilst on tour. This does come at an extra cost.

  • E

    Edward

    Asked on July 19th, 2022

    do you know how much ski rental would cost (i.e. ski's and ski shoes) for the period of this Ski Voyager tour?

    Price / Availability
    Tour Details
    • Wild KiwiOperatorWritten July 2022

      Ski passes are $100 per day and full ski hire about $150 for 3 days. Depending on how much you are looking to ski.
